David Négrier d785a8a1bf Refactoring connection to be part of a GameScene
Most of the refactoring issues we are seeing are probably due to the fact that we are trying to manipulate a ScenePlugin out of a Scene (the GameManager is not a Scene and holds a reference to a ScenePlugin coming from a Scene that might get invalidated by Phaser 3).
Furthermore, if we want in the future to be able to scale, scenes could be hosted on different servers. Therefore, it makes no sense to have one connexion for the whole application.
Instead, we should have one connexion for each scene.

David Négrier 125a4d11af Refactored and optimized messages
Now, when a user moves, only his/her position is sent back to the other users. The position of all users is not sent each time.

The messages sent to the browser are now:

- the list of all users as a return to the join_room event (you can send responses to events in socket.io)
- a "join_room" event sent when a new user joins the room
- a "user_moved" event when a user moved
- a "user_left" event when a user left the room

The GameScene tracks all these events and reacts accordingly.

Also, I made a number of refactoring in the classes and removed the GameSceneInterface that was useless (it was implemented by the LogincScene for no reason at all)
